Elgin, Illinois
1929 - 2017
George H. Edgar, born June 25, 1929 in East Chicago, Indiana, passed away surrounded by family on January 6, 2017. George was 87 years old. George was a graduate of East Chicago Roosevelt High School (Indiana), where he met his future wife, June A Rollo. They were married on August 22, 1953....
